A. approach B. attain C. deficit-oriented D. eager E. fail
F. formal G. generally H. knowledge-oriented I. lose J. particularly
K. pressures L. surroundings M. tension N. unwilling O. weird
Never underestimate the learning power of play. One of Parks’ findings is that children 【C1】______ valuable learning opportunities when unstructured play is reduced or eliminated in favor of more time in the classroom. "I think a lot of public school systems 【C2】______to see the importance of play," says Parks, assistant professor of early childhood education. "Right now, play is under-valued and lot of that is because of top-down 【C3】______ over standards and testing. Their work is often framed in trying to figure out what’s wrong with these kids. It’s very 【C4】______ and not at all what I experienced as a classroom teacher. "
"I found the children 【C5】______ to learn, and their families were supportive and curious," she adds. "So when I got to academia, I thought it was 【C6】______ to read all these studies about kids not being prepared, or not being able to solve problems."
So she designed her own research project with a different 【C7】______. She is following the same minority group of 14 young children for three years, starting in preschool, to see how they learn mathematics, both in the 【C8】______ classroom setting as well as informally in school, and at home. "Just sitting there, looking at what is happening in their natural 【C9】______, you can find things that surprise you," she says.
She hopes her research will prove how important play is to developing problem-solving skills, and in other critical ways. But there is something else, just as important for Parks. "It is the equity piece of trying to change the conversation in the research community about what kids can do 【C10】______, and what minority kids can do in particular," she says. [br] 【C5】
选项
答案
D
解析
此处为“find sb./sth.+adj.”结构,因此空格处应填入形容词。后半句提及家长的态度是很积极的(supportive and curious),且句中使用了表示语义顺承的连词and,由此可知孩子的态度也应该是积极的,故选D项eager“渴望的”。
